Outline:
Determine equilibrium constant for Cobalt chloride reaction. Check the effect of temperature and concentration on equilibrium. Application of Le-Châtelier’s Principle on the equilibrium. Use the pipet to withdraw and pour the solution into the flask. Check the colour change on addition of hydrochloric acid. Calculate Equilibrium Constant using the given formula. Define Le-Châtelier’s Principle. Calculate the equilibrium constant at higher temperature. Compare the values of equilibrium constants at different temperatures. Carry out the reaction between cobalt complex and silver nitrate and analyse the results.
